VeriFacts Automotive Names New Director of Sales and Marketing

July 24, 2013

July 24, 2013— VeriFacts Automotive recently named Laura Delmege-Darr as director of sales and marketing.

Delmege-Darr was formerly the CEO of Chelsea Group where she assisted collision repair operators with business strengthening strategies and provided consulting advice to many of the key insurers and vendors in the collision industry.

“Laura is uniquely qualified for her position at VeriFacts and her vast experience in the automotive industry provides her with a great perspective from which to cultivate future clients,” said Doug Irish, president of Verifacts.

“I have known Laura for a very long time through my association with the Chelsea Group,” said Farzam Afshar, CEO VeriFacts. “She has the drive, passion, and determination to be very successful in this position and I welcome her to our team.”
